Prayer

Dear God,

I come to You with gratitude in my heart for the gift of health. Thank You for the strength in my body, the clarity in my mind, and the hope in my spirit.

Help me to honor my body as a temple, treating it with kindness and care. Guide me to make choices that promote wellness and continue to bless me with the energy to fulfill my daily tasks.

I ask for Your healing presence for those times when illnesses or fatigue challenge me. Give me the patience to endure, the wisdom to seek the right treatments, and the peace that surpasses understanding.

Surround me with support, love, and encouragement when I need it most. May I be a beacon of health and vitality, inspiring others to embrace their well-being.

Thank You for Your unwavering love and protection. In Your name, I pray. Amen.

Journal Prompts about Health

Certainly! Here are eight journal prompts that explore health from a biblical perspective:

  1. Temple of the Holy Spirit: Reflect on 1 Corinthians 6:19-20. How do you view your body as a temple of the Holy Spirit, and what steps can you take to honor God with your body?

  2. Physical and Spiritual Health: Consider 3 John 1:2, where John wishes for good health just as the soul prospers. How do you balance your physical health with spiritual well-being?

  3. Rest and Sabbath: Meditate on Exodus 20:8-11 about keeping the Sabbath holy. How can regular rest and reflection contribute to your physical and spiritual health?

  4. Diet and Gratitude: Reflect on Genesis 1:29 regarding God providing every seed-bearing plant for food. How can gratitude and mindful eating enhance your health journey?

  5. Healing and Faith: Think about James 5:14-15, which speaks about prayer and healing. How does your faith play a role in your approach to health and healing?

  6. Stress and Peace: Ponder Philippians 4:6-7 about letting the peace of God guard your heart and mind. How can you apply this peace to manage stress in your life?

  7. Community and Support: Reflect on Galatians 6:2, which encourages bearing one another’s burdens. How can community support influence your health positively?

  8. Exercise and Endurance: Consider 1 Timothy 4:8, which states that physical training is of some value. How can you incorporate physical activity as a means of glorifying God?
